How to Install Drip Irrigation in Willamette Valley Clay Soil
This guide provides a technical approach to installing an efficient drip system that overcomes the slow drainage and compaction common in Lane County's heavy clay soils. Following these steps ensures deep root penetration and prevents water pooling around your plants.
What You'll Need
- Drip irrigation kit (emitters, tubing, and connectors)
- Pressure regulator
- Automatic timer
- Garden trowel or narrow spade
- Organic compost or soil conditioner
- Mulch (bark or straw)
Steps
Step 1: Plan for Low Absorption
Map your garden layout and identify areas where clay is most compacted. Because Willamette Valley clay absorbs water slowly, plan for longer watering cycles with more frequent breaks to prevent runoff.
Step 2: Install the Header System
Connect your timer and pressure regulator to the main water source. Run a primary poly-tubing line along the edge of your planting beds, securing it with stakes to keep it flush against the soil surface.
Step 3: Amend the Planting Sites
Before laying emitters, dig small holes at the base of each plant and mix in organic compost. This improves the soil structure locally, allowing the drip water to penetrate deeper into the clay rather than sitting on the surface.
Step 4: Lay the Drip Lines
Run secondary distribution lines or emitter tubing to each plant. Use punch-in emitters for individual shrubs and soaker-style drip lines for denser garden beds, ensuring the tubing is snug against the ground.
Step 5: Position Emitters Strategically
Place emitters slightly away from the main stem of the plant to encourage outward root growth. In heavy clay, avoid placing emitters directly against the trunk to prevent root rot caused by excessive moisture retention.
Step 6: Flush the System
Run the water for a few minutes without the end caps attached to clear out any debris from the lines. Once flushed, seal the ends of the tubing to maintain the pressure required for consistent dripping.
Step 7: Apply a Heavy Mulch Layer
Cover the entire irrigation system with 2 to 3 inches of organic mulch. This prevents the clay soil from baking into a hard crust, which would otherwise force water to run off the surface instead of soaking in.
Expert Tips
- Use a 'cycle and soak' timer setting to allow clay soil time to absorb water between pulses.
- Avoid tilling the clay soil when wet, as this creates a concrete-like compaction that blocks water flow.
- Check emitters monthly for mineral buildup, which is common with the local water chemistry.
- Install a rain sensor to prevent overwatering during the region's wet winter months.
